Company Overview
FUJIFILM Sonosite reinvents how healthcare is delivered with point-of-care ultrasound technology. As a leader in bedside ultrasound systems, our innovations save lives—from premature babies in NICUs to trauma patients in emergency rooms. We seek purpose-driven team members ready to build technology that impacts real-world scenarios, including natural disasters and war zones. Our headquarters is in Bothell, WA, near Seattle. Fujifilm is globally headquartered in Tokyo with over 70,000 employees across healthcare, electronics, business innovation, and imaging.
